couple of odd things going on there, I would just wipe everything clean (or rename the SS2 folder and move it to a backup folder), get a fresh GOG install, patch it with the latest tool, get the latest versions of all the mods, load them up, and play.

voodoo47Thanks You for quick reply. Ok, understood. But i want to know what mods i am using before? Any chances to do that?

6648a09543e64voodoo47

6648a09543ec4
well, you can check your current SS2 folder and see whether the mod folders are still there somewhere (maybe SS2ToolSyncBackup), but if you have merged all the mods into one folder in the past (there is a weird data folder inside your current dmm folder) then you will not know, unless the readme files are still there (if you see a Rebirth readme somewhere, then you had Rebirth installed, probably).

Did you manually unzip mods to install them? It looks like when you installed mods, you installed them all to the DMM folder directly, rather than subfolders, so they are all combined into one mod.

Which likely means files have been overwritten and things are broken.

Doesn't look to me like an ss2tool or dmm problem.
